A European Forum for a World Without Orphans: Bucharest, Romania, 10–13 March 2026 

WORSHIP – CONNECT – LEARN – PLAN – ACT 

World Without Orphans Europe warmly invites you to "Hope in Action," a forum specifically designed for individuals and organizations dedicated to supporting vulnerable children, families, and orphans across Europe. 

Conflict and crisis fill our headlines these days, but God offers hope for those in distress and calls us to action. WWO Europe has been called to bring love and justice to vulnerable children through collaborative efforts. Join us at our upcoming forum as we gather to advance our mission of providing a safe and loving family for every child. 

Hope in Action will highlight areas that the WWO Europe team is currently working on with national "Without Orphans" teams and their leaders. We'll learn from experts and each other, engage in meaningful discussions, and create plans and commitments to put into action after the forum—whether on our own, within our organisations and churches, or together with our partners. 

At this gathering, we will unite in prayer, seek spiritual refreshment, dream boldly, and plan together to respond with greater impact to this call.

 

WHAT TO EXPECT – THE PROGRAMME 

  • Worship and prayer as a community
  • Training in the World Without Orphans Roadmap
  • Opportunities for personal prayer and encouragement
  • Networking with others involved in family strengthening and orphan care in your region
  • A day devoted to planning strategically in a focus area of your choice
  • Free time for fellowship and building connections 

 

HOPE IN ACTION – WORKING GROUPS 

  • Children on the Move: Sharing experiences and insights, building on the pilot from Moldova
  • Children with Disabilities: Engaging with our Disabilities working group to develop a strategy to change the culture of care
  • Church Engagement: Building on recent initiatives in Albania and drawing from expertise within international partnerships and "Without Orphans" movements in Romania and Ukraine
  • Safeguarding/Child Protection: Developing strategies to strengthen child protection in Europe
  • Rethinking Orphanages (by invitation only): Connecting church and mission leaders from nations with strong support for mission and orphan care with practitioners in recipient countries. Together, we’ll explore the best ways to serve children and how to achieve genuine partnership in the Gospel.

C Muwanguzi - Mugalu (Prefer to be called Muwa) is a catalytic African leader and social transformation strategist committed to advancing equity by shifting power to communities. With 25+ years of experience across social impact and international development, he has led and advised community-rooted work that strengthens families and enables children to thrive in safe, loving care.

He previously served as CEO of Child’s i Foundation, helping to pioneer scalable alternatives to child institutionalisation in Uganda and across Africa, and now works with Nyaka to drive innovation, embed sustainability, and champion lived-experience leadership within grassroots organisations ready to scale. Christopher serves on multiple boards, including VSO International (Safeguarding Lead), Learn to Play (Botswana),  Kyaninga Child Development Centre. He holds an MA in Child and Family Development from Tavistock and Portman and an MBA from Bayes Business School.

Liviu Mihăileanu is an adoptive father and a leading advocate for adoption and foster care reform in Romania. His work has influenced national policy, strengthened civil society, and mobilized faith-based and professional communities around child protection. He is the founder of Tzuby’s Kids Association and President of the Romania Without Orphans Alliance. In recognition of his legislative and public advocacy, he received the Golden PR Award for Excellence in 2020. Liviu holds a PhD in theology, researching the role of Christian communities in adoption, and is the author of ”Born of the Heart” and ”The Lost Treasure”. Professionally, he serves as Director of Research & Knowledge for PwC EMEA, bringing extensive experience in strategy, governance, and organizational leadership.

Nicole Baldonado is a trauma-certified social worker specializing in psychosocial support for caregivers in humanitarian crises. She is the Chief of Programme Development and Implementation for the Global Hope Groups Collaborative.

Hope Groups have randomized control evidence showing 57% improvements in parental mental health, 65% improvements in hopefulness and resilience, 54% decreases in violence against children, and 56% decreases in child behavioral issues amidst war and displacement. Mrs. Baldonado collaborated with international trauma-experts and Ukrainian refugees to develop, implement and evaluate the Hope Groups for Ukrainians impacted by war, including people in war zones, internally displaced or living as refugees. Nearly 4,000 Ukrainians have participated in Hope Groups in thirteen countries.

Mrs. Baldonado has also been a co-investigator on a pre-post study and a randomized control trial of the Hope Groups for Ukraine, in collaboration with University of Oxford, World Without Orphans, Parenting for Lifelong Health, the Global Parenting Initiative, and the Global Reference Group for Children Affected by Crisis. She has since led cultural adaptations and implementation support for Hope Groups evaluations in Colombia, Jordan, the West Bank, Sudan, and Chad, and pilots in Kenya, Malaysia, India, and Uganda. She has over 25 years of experience living in Eastern Europe, including Ukraine, Hungary and Poland, where she now resides as a refugee from the war in Ukraine. She has a background in multi-sector collaboration across government, non-profit and grassroots community organizations, and human trafficking prevention on the U.S. statewide level.
